Standardization of duration for accelerated ageing in barnyard millet cv. CO2 and MDU 1

S.Venkatesan
K.Sujatha
R.Geetha
N.Senthil

Abstract

The study was carried out to identify the pattern of seed deterioration in barnyard millet. Physiological quality parameters 
were evaluated to predict their storability through accelerated ageing at 40 ± 1° C and 100 % RH for 12 days. Based on the 
physiological quality parameters the duration of ageing required to reach a germination percentage around 75% (IMSCS) 
was identified as nine days for CO 2 and eight days for MDU 1.
